ERIE, Pa. - Xavier Hollamon will spend at least the next 12.5 to 25 years in jail for attempted homicide last summer, a judge decided during sentencing Monday.

Hollamon shot Dayquan Robison twice in the chest in an argument over $20 near East 25th and Ash streets back on August 24, 2013.

In February, a jury found Hollamon guilty of attempted homicide in that shooting.

The incident occurred a few weeks after Hollamon got off probation for his role in a murder case.

He served 10 months for helping his girlfriend at the time, Tania Coleman, hide the body of her 14-month-old baby in 2011.

The infant was found starved to death in a suitcase put out with the trash.
